My cordless 
handset does 
not ring when I 
receive a call.
•  Make sure that the ringer is not turned off. 
Refer to the section(s) on ringer selection 
in the manual provided with your TL92278/
TL92328/TL92378 telephone.
•  Make sure the telephone line cord is 
plugged securely into the telephone base 
and the telephone jack. Make sure the 
power cord is securely plugged in.
•  The cordless handset may be too far from 
the telephone base.
•  Charge the battery in the cordless handset 
for at least 16 hours. For optimum daily 
performance, return the cordless handset 
to its base when not in use.
•  You may have too many extension phones 
on your telephone line to allow all of them 
to ring simultaneously. Try unplugging 
some of the other phones.
•  The layout of your home or office might 
be limiting the operating range. Try moving 
the telephone base to another location, 
preferably on an upper floor.
•  If the other phones in your home are 
having the same problem, the problem is in 
your wiring or local service. Contact your 
local telephone company (charges may 
apply).
•  Test a working phone at the phone jack. If 
another phone has the same problem, the 
problem is the phone jack. Contact your 
local telephone company (charges may 
apply).
